1.Disease onset regions and spreading patterns in sporadic amyotrophic lateral sclerosis and related influencing factors
Jingxia DANG ; Jiaoting JIN ; Fangfang HU ; Rui JIA
Journal of Xi'an Jiaotong University(Medical Sciences) 2015;(4):505-508,542
Objective To evaluate the disease onset regions and spreading patterns in sporadic amyotrophic lateral sclerosis (ALS)patients and related influencing factors.Methods We performed a prospective analysis of 1 58 ALS patients.The disease-onset was confirmed according to the patients’self-reports,neurological examination results and electromyogram study.We followed up 1 5 1 patients with the second or other affected body regions during the disease progression.Data were analyzed according to the different groups of onset regions.Results 1.In 94.3% (149/1 58)of the patients,the early motor manifestations were focally in the bulbar,upper or lower limbs.2.The region of onset was associated with signs of lower motor neuron (LMN)and upper motor neuron (UMN)involvement (P = 0.000 ).The LMN involvement was more distinctive in patients with bulbar onset (65.4%,1 7/26 )group.Patients with cervical onset more frequently showed pure LMN (47.9%,45/94 )or concomitant UMN (52.1%,49/94)signs in the affected limbs.The highest proportion of UMN and LMN signs in the affected lower limb was found in the lumbar onset (83.8%,31/37 )group.3.Spreading patterns:Rostral to caudal spreading pattern was more frequent in bulbar onset patients.For patients with limb onset,there were significant differences between spreading patterns and disease-onset regions (P =0.04).Circular (31.5%,28/89),horizontal (30.3%,31/89)and vertical (21.3%,1 9/89)spreading patterns were more frequent in cervical onset patients whereas circular (47.2%,1 7/36)spreading patterns were more frequent in lumbar onset patients.4.There was a strong association between the rate of progression and age of disease onset (P =0.01 1).Patients aged over 60 had a faster progression.Conclusion ALS is a focal process at motor axis along the spinal cord and cerebral cortex.Different disease-onset can cause different distribution of UMN and LMN signs.Therefore,special attention should be paid to the signs of disease-onset clinically.ALS does start focally and spreads to adjacent regions.Elder patients have a faster disease progression.
2.Antioxidation of Picroside Ⅱ on Cerebral Ischemic Injury in Rats and Its Optimum Dosage and Time Window
Fangfang PANG ; Meizeng ZHANG ; Rui ZHANG ; Yiling WU ; Qi XU ; Liang ZHONG
Chinese Journal of Information on Traditional Chinese Medicine 2013;(11):40-43
Objective To optimize the therapeutic dose and time window of picroside Ⅱ in treating cerebral ischemic injury in rats by orthogonal test. Methods The forebrain ischemia models were established by bilateral common carotid artery occlusion (BCCAO) method. The successful models were randomly grouped according to orthogonal experimental design and treated by injecting picroside Ⅱintraperitoneally at different ischemic time with different doses. The concentrations of MDA, NO and H2O2 in serum and brain tissue were respectively determined by thiobarbituric acid assay, nitratase reductase assay and chemiluminescence immunoassay. Results The optimized composition of the therapeutic dose and time window of picroside Ⅱ in cerebral ischemic injury were ischemia 1.5 h with 10 mg/kg, 1.5 h with 20 mg/kg and 1.5 h with 10 mg/kg body weight according to the expressions of MDA, NO and H2O2 in serum, and ischemia 1.5 h with 10 mg/kg, 1.5 h with 20 mg/kg and 1.5 h with 20 mg/kg body weight according to the expressions of MDA, NO and H2O2 in brain tissue. Conclusion On the basis of the principle of lowest therapeutic dose with longest time window, the optimized composition of the therapeutic dose and time window in cerebral ischemic injury is injecting picroside Ⅱ intraperitoneally with 10-20 mg/kg body weight at ischemia 1.5 h.
3.Application of capillary electrophoresis in the diagnosis and differential diagnosis of benign and malignant monoclonal gammopathies
Fangfang CAO ; Mengyang LIU ; Ning DU ; Rui ZHANG ; Yuan YUAN ; Jing LIU
Chinese Journal of Laboratory Medicine 2021;44(6):486-491
Objective:To evaluate the value of capillary electrophoresis in the diagnosis and differential diagnosis of benign and malignant monoclonal gammopathies (MGs).Methods:A retrospective analysis of the capillary electrophoresis test results of 2 445 newly diagnosed patients at the Affiliated Hospital of Qingdao University from January 2016 to June 2020 was carried out. Capillary zone electrophoresis and immunosubtractive assay were used to detect serum monoclonal protein (MP). The clinical diagnosis and other information of the patients were collected from the clinical database of the Affiliated Hospital of Qingdao University. Kruskal-Wallis rank sum test was used to compare the different amount of monoclonal protein among multiple groups. Receiver operator characteristic curve (ROC) was used to analyze the diagnostic sensitivity and specificity of the monoclonal protein of each type. Youden index was used to calculate the cut-off values.Results:Among the 2 445 patients, 1 183 were positive for monoclonal protein, of which 944 cases were diagnosed as malignant MG, 174 were monoclonal gammopathy of undetermined significance (MGUS), and 65 cases were monoclonal gammopathy of renal significance (MGRS). The percentages of M protein types from high to low is immunoglobulin G(IgG)-κ, IgG-λ, IgA-λ, IgA-κ, free λ light chain, free κ light chain, IgM-κ, double clone, and IgM-λ. The levels of MP of IgG, IgA, IgM and FLC in the malignant MG group were all higher than those in the MGUS group, with statistical significance( P<0.01). The MP levels of IgG and IgA types in malignant MG group were higher than that in MGRS group ( P<0.01). ROC curve analysis showed that the MP of IgG, IgA, IgM and FLC types had good diagnostic efficacy for malignant MG ( P<0.01), and their AUC values were 0.947 (95 %CI 0.926-0.968), 0.930 (95 %CI 0.895-0.966), 0.844 (95 %CI 0.722-0.967) and 0.865 (95 %CI 0.781-0.950), respectively. For IgG, the cut-off value was 14.24 g/L, and the diagnostic sensitivity and specificity were 88.5% and 90.1%, respectively. The cut-off value of IgA was 8.88 g/L, and the sensitivity and specificity of IgA were 87.9% and 81.4%, respectively. For IgM, the cut-off value was 26.93 g/L, and the sensitivity was 64.4% and the specificity was 90.9%. For FLC, the cut-off value, diagnostic sensitivity, and specificity was 7.08 g/L, 85.9%, and 77.8%, respectively. Conclusions:Capillary electrophoresis immunotyping technique can be used to diagnose malignant MG such as multiple myeloma (MM) and non-Hodgkin′s lymphoma (NHL), as well as to screen and track diseases like MGUS and MGRS. Serum MP level can be used to distinguish malignant MG from benign MG effectively.
4.The observation on the effect of Buyang Huanwu Decoction combined with suspension exercise training for the patients with cerebral infarction and lower limb hemiplegia
Fangfang CAO ; Qian ZHENG ; Rui ZHANG ; Weiqing CHEN ; Sen LIN
International Journal of Traditional Chinese Medicine 2022;44(3):268-272
Objective:To explore the curative effect of Buyang Huanwu Decoction combined with suspension exercise training for the patients with cerebral infarction combined and lower limb hemiplegia.Methods:According to random number table method, 94 patients with cerebral infarction and lower limb hemiplegia meeting the inclusion criteria were divided into the control group and the observation group between January 2017 and February 2021, 47 in each group. The control group was treated with suspension exercise training, while observation group was additionally treated with Buyang Huanwu Decoction on the basis of the control group treatment. All were treated for 6 weeks and then followed up for 3 months. Before and after treatment, the Traditional Chinese Medicine (TCM) syndromes scores were recorded. The severity of nerve function injury was evaluated by National Institutes of Health Stroke Scale (NIHSS). The lower limb function was evaluated by Fugl-Meyer Assessment (FMA). The balance function was evaluated by Berg Balance Scale (BBS). The activities of daily life were assessed by Barthel Index (BI). The whole blood high shear viscosity, plasma viscosity and hematocrit were detected by full-automatic hemorheology analyzer. The levels of plasma total cholesterol (TC), triglyceride (TG) and low-density lipoprotein cholesterol (LDL-C) were detected by full-automatic analyzer. All were followed up for 3 months. The prognosis of patients was assessed by modified Rankin scale (mRS). The adverse reactions during treatment were recorded.Results:After treatment, scores of TCM syndromes and NIHSS in observation group were significantly lower than those in control group ( t=5.35, 4.54, P<0.01), while scores of FMA, BBS and BI were significantly higher than those in control group ( t=3.40, 3.10, 7.57, P<0.01). The whole blood high-shear viscosity, plasma viscosity and hematocrit in observation group were significantly lower than those in control group ( t=2.94, 3.81, 4.23, P<0.05 or P<0.01), and levels of TC, TG and LDL-C were significantly lower than those in control group ( t=4.10, 4.27, 3.61, P<0.01). The differences in good prognosis rate between observation group and control group were statistically significant [74.47% (35/47) vs. 51.06% (24/47); χ2=5.51, P=0.019]. Conclusion:The Buyang Huanwu Decoction combined with suspension exercise training can relieve clinical symptoms, recover lower limb function, improve activities of daily life and prognosis in cerebral infarction combined with lower limb hemiplegia.
5.Analysis of styryllactones from Goniothalamus cheliensis by UPLC-Q-TOF-MS.
Miaomiao JIANG ; Wen RUI ; Fangfang FU ; Lilii ZHAO ; Xinsheng YAO ; Yifan FENG
China Journal of Chinese Materia Medica 2011;36(10):1322-1326
OBJECTIVETo analyze the styryllactone components in Goniothalamus cheliensis Hu (Annonaceae).
METHODUPLC-Q-TOF-MS was used to identify the main styryllactone components in G. cheliensis. The chromatographic separation was performed on ACQU ITY UPLC BEH C18 column and eluted by actonitrile and 0.1% acetic acid in water gradiently. The mass spectrometer equipped with electrospray ionization souce was used as detector under the positive ion modes.
RESULTTwelve styryllactons were identified based on their MS data and published literatures, and the MS fragmentation regularity of the styryllactones was also proposed.
CONCLUSIONIt is an accurate and effective method to obtain the structural information of styryllactones.

6.Expression changes of miRNAs and EMT-related genes in human mesothelial cells induced by long-term exposure to asbestos
Rui LI ; Wenke YU ; Qi WANG ; Lijin ZHU ; Fangfang ZHANG
Chinese Journal of Industrial Hygiene and Occupational Diseases 2024;42(9):668-672
Objective:To investigate the effects of long-term exposure to chrysotile and crocidolite on miRNAs and epithelial mesenchymal transformation (EMT) -related gene expression in human pleural mesothelial cells.Methods:In November 2020, fluorescence quantitative polymerase chain reaction (RT-qPCR) was used to detect the expressions of EMT-related genes in human pleural mesothelioma cells (NCl-H2052 cells, NCl-H2452 cells) and human normal mesothelial cells (Met-5A cells). MiRNAs with abnormal expression in human pleural mesothelioma cells were screened out from the previous miRNA chip data of research group, and target genes of differentially expressed miRNAs were predicted using miRWalk database (http: //mirwalk.umm.uni-heidelberg.de). RT-qPCR was used to verify the abnormal expression of EMT-related miRNAs in cell lines. Met-5A cells were treated with 5μg/cm 2 chrysotile and crocidolite respectively for 48 h a time, once a week and a total of 10 times. Chrysotile group, crocidolite group and control group were set up. And the control group was added with the same volume of PBS. The expression changes of EMT-related genes and abnormal expression miRNAs in each group were detected by RT-qPCR. The differences among the groups were compared by one-way ANOVA, and the differences between the control group and the experimental group were compared by dunnet- t test. Results:Compared with Met-5A cells, the expression levels of Vimentin and Twist genes were increased, and the expression level of E-cadherin genes was decreased in NCl-H2052 cells and NCl-H2452 cells ( P<0.001). Target genes of miRNAs with abnormal expression in miRNA chip were predicted, and the results showed four abnormally expressed miRNAs associated with EMT and verified the expression of these four miRNAs in the cell lines. Compared with Met-5A cells, the expression level of hsa-miR-155-5p was increased in NCl-H2052 cells and NCl-H2452 cells, the expression levels of hsa-miR-34b-5p, hsa-miR-34c-5p and hsa-miR-28-5p were decreased in NCl-H2052 cells and NCl-H2452 cells ( P<0.001), which was consistent with the results of chip analysis. After exposure of Met-5A cells, it was found that compared with the control group, the expression levels of Vimentin and Twist genes, hsa-miR-155-5p, hsa-miR-34b-5p and hsa-miR-34c-5p in the crocidolite group were increased, while the expression level of E-cadherin gene was decreased ( P<0.05). Compared with the control group, the expression levels of Vimentin, Twist and E-cadherin genes in chrysotile group were increased, while the expression levels of hsa-miR-34b-5p, hsa-miR-34c-5p and hsa-miR-28-5p were decreased ( P<0.05) . Conclusion:Long-term exposure to chrysotile and crocidolite could cause Met-5A cells to produce miRNAs and EMT-related gene expression changes similar to mesothelioma cells.

8.Assessment and management of post stroke fatigue:a summary of best evidence
Fangfang ZHANG ; Xiaofang DONG ; Rui LIANG ; Lin ZHANG ; Yanjin LIU
Modern Clinical Nursing 2024;23(9):64-71
Objective To retrieve evidences on the assessment and management of post-stroke fatigue and summarise the best evidences.Method Evidence-based nursing was employed to systematically retrieve the literatures on assessment and management of post-stroke fatigue from both foreign and domestic databases,including BMJ Best Practice,UpToDate,Joanna Briggs Institute(JBI)Evidence-Based Health Care Centre Database,American Guide Network,Scottish Intercollegiate Guide Network,Medlive,Cochrane Library,PubMed,CNKI and Wanfang Data.Joanna Briggs Institute(JBI)critical appraisal tool was used to assess the evidences retrieved from the databases.Results A total of two evidence-related summaries,five clinical practice guidelines and twenty systematic reviews were included.After evidence extraction and aggregation,three evidence-related themes were identified:assessment,behavioral intervention and health education and they comprised 18 pieces of best evidence on post-stroke fatigue.Conclusion This study summarised the best evidences for the assessment and management of post-stroke fatigue in patients.The best evidences provide nursing managers with valuable references in conducting evidence-based post-stroke nursing hence to prevent post-stroke fatigue and improve the quality of nursing care.
9.Relationship between parenting rearing behaviors and adolescent depression: the mediating role of rumination
Fangfang ZHANG ; Rui GAO ; Haiyan YANG
Sichuan Mental Health 2025;38(2):145-152
BackgroundSeveral studies have confirmed that there is a relationship among parenting rearing behaviors, adolescent depression and rumination, moreover, rumination has been found to mediate the relationship between overall parenting rearing behaviors and adolescent depression, while little is known about the mediating role of rumination in the relationship between each dimension of parenting rearing behaviors and adolescent depression. ObjectiveTo explore the mediating role of rumination in the relationship between each dimension of parenting rearing behaviors and adolescent depression, so as to provide reference for the prevention of adolescent depression. MethodsIn March and April 2022, a stratified random sampling technique was utilized to select 302 students in grades 7 to 12 at a middle school in Ningxian county, Gansu Province as the research subjects. The Beck Depression Inventory-II of Chinese Version (BDI-II-C), short-form Egna Minnen av Barndoms Uppfostran (S-EMBU) and Ruminative Response Scale (RRS) were administered to all subjects. Pearson correlation coefficients were calculated. Amos 24.0 was used to check the presence of mediation effect. ResultsA total of 302 (94.08%) completed valid questionnaires. Correlation analysis indicated that the scores of both father's and mother's emotional warmth dimension in the S-EMBU were negatively correlated with the BDI-II-C scores (r=-0.424, -0.297, P<0.01), RRS total score (r=-0.347~-0.175, P<0.01) and RRS each factor score (r=-0.179~-0.285, P<0.01); the scores of both father's and mother's rejection dimension in the S-EMBU were positively correlated with the BDI-II-C scores (r=0.355, 0.248, P<0.01), RRS total score (r=0.262~0.358, P<0.01) and RRS each factor score (r=0.274~0.339, P<0.01); the scores of both father's and mother's overprotection dimension in the S-EMBU were positively correlated with the BDI-II-C scores (r=0.286, 0.245, P<0.01), RRS total score (r=0.175~0.333, P<0.01) and RRS each factor score (r=0.150~0.255, P<0.01). Rumination might mediated the relationship of father's emotional warmth, father's overprotection, mother's overprotection, and mother's rejection with adolescent depression, the effect value were -0.110, 0.221, -0.121, 0.136, and the effect size were 36.07%, 100.00%, 100.00%, 100.00%. ConclusionRumination may play a mediation role in the relationship of father's emotional warmth, father's overprotection, mother's overprotection, and mother's rejection with adolescent depression. 10.Hospitalization rates for influenza?associated severe acute respiratory illness in children younger than five years old in Suzhou of China, 2016-2018
Wanqing ZHANG ; Jia YU ; Liling CHEN ; Fangfang CHENG ; Rui ZHANG ; Junmei GAO ; Jun ZHANG ; Gemming ZHAO ; Jianmei TIAN ; Tao ZHANG
Chinese Journal of Preventive Medicine 2019;53(10):1056-1059
We analyzed the influenza surveillance data of Children′s Hospital of Suzhou University from 2016 to 2018 and estimated the hospitalization burden of children under 5 years old due to influenza infection in Suzhou. The results showed that the influenza virus positive rate of 1 451 severe acute respiratory infection (SARI) cases in Children′s Hospital of Suzhou University was 13.6% (95%CI :11.8%?15.3%;197 cases), among which the influenza pandemic intensity in 2017?2018 was relatively high, and A/H1N1 was the main pandemic virus. It was estimated that the hospitalization rate of influenza?related SARI in children under 5 years old in Suzhou was 6.9‰ (95%CI : 6.6‰?7.2‰), among which the hospitalization rate of children aged<6 months was higher, up to 11.4‰(95%CI: 9.9‰?12.8‰).
